Our Accessibility Commitment
We aim to meet the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ines version 2.1, Level AA. These guidelines explain how to make web content more accessible for people with a wide range of disabilities, including visual, auditory, physical, speech, cognitive, language, learning, and neurological disabilities. Following these standards also makes our service easier to use for all customers in Queens Park and the surrounding areas.

Screen-Reader Support
Our website is designed to work with modern screen-reader software. We use headings, paragraphs, and other structural HTML elements to present information in a logical order, which helps users who navigate by heading or landmarks. Images relevant to our man and van services in Queens Park are given descriptive text where appropriate so that screen-reader users can understand the purpose of visual content. We aim to keep our language clear and concise, avoiding unnecessary jargon that may make content harder to understand.
Keyboard Navigation
The site is developed to be navigable by keyboard alone, without the use of a mouse. People who rely on keyboard navigation should be able to move through menus, forms, and content areas using standard keyboard commands such as the Tab, Shift plus Tab, Enter, and Space keys. Focus indicators are designed to be visible so that users can see which element is currently selected. This helps people with motor impairments and those who prefer or need to avoid using a mouse when accessing our man and van Queens Park information.
Text, Colour, and Layout
We aim to provide sufficient colour contrast between text and background so that content is easier to read for users with low vision or colour vision deficiencies. Text is written in plain language wherever possible, with short sentences and clear headings to support people with cognitive or learning disabilities. The layout is designed to reflow on different devices and screen sizes so that customers can access our man and van Queens Park details on desktops, tablets, and mobile phones.
